A World Economic Forum report about Central Bank Digital Currency
The World Economic Forum has published a report on Central Bank Digital Currency (CBDC), revealing that 40 central banks around the world are involved in the development of fintech services and tools. These include the Bank of Canada, the Bank of England and the Monetary Authority of Singapore (MAS), as producing the most research to date. According to the WEF report, emerging country central banks may be the biggest beneficiaries of CBDCs.
